Downcomers For Mass Transfer Column

Abstract:
The present disclosure is directed to an improved mass-transfer column, the column comprising a plurality of trays and associated downcomers, wherein at least one of the downcomers comprises an upstream and downstream end, as defined by the direction of flow of liquid through the column, the upstream and downstream end each having an opening defined by a plurality of walls, wherein each of the walls extend substantially entirely between the upstream opening and the downstream opening, and wherein at least one of the walls has at least two sections, a first section of the wall forming an angle α with a plane parallel to the associated tray, and a second section of the wall, which forms an angle β with a plane parallel to the associated tray, wherein said second section is downstream from the first section, and α
